Summer 2025 Program Costs 

NOTE: tuition is broken down into three tiers - in-state, out-of-state, and out-of-country students.

Tuition and Fees are collected by the Bursar, according to the same due dates as the Atlanta campus. 

Fees are calculated based on 10 semester hours for the estimate below. 

GT/BURSAR CHARGES 
GTE Program Deposit 
(paid at time of application via the Study Abroad application portal)

$500

GTE Remaining Program Charge 
(total program charges = $4,100; ie, $500 deposit + $3,600)

$3,600

Mandatory GT Fees

$107

Tuition – In-State (resident of GA) - based on 10 semester hours

*$3,504

$350.40 per SCH x 10

Tuition - Out-of-State (non-resident of GA) - based on 10 semester hours 

*$10,979.30

$1,097.93 per SCH x 10

Tuition - Out-of-Country (international)  - based on 10 semester hours

*$11,188.60

$1,118.86 per SCH x 10

TOTAL FEES CHARGED TO STUDENTS 

Note that in May 2025, students will be charged the amount below,
less the $500 deposit that has already been paid.

In-State (resident of GA)

*$7,711

Out-of-State (non-resident of GA)

*$15,186.30

Out-of-Country (international)

*$15,395.60
